RE: [vintagesynthrepair] poly 61 sound output failure

2002-02-13 by Wul

Check the fuse on the psu board, the output circuits are fed from a +15v
supply whereas the digital side of things is fed from +5v let me know if you
need anymore help and i'll scan the part of the drawing that you require . I
